Abdominal retractors are foundational surgical instruments designed to hold back organs, tissues, and abdominal wall structures during complex open laparotomies, oncological resections, organ transplants, and gynecological procedures. In high-volume surgical hubs like Greater Los Angeles—home to world-renowned institutions such as UCLA Health, Cedars-Sinai Medical Center, Keck Medicine of USC, and Kaiser Permanente Southern California—the demand for reliable, ergonomically balanced, and highly durable retractor systems has reached an all-time high.
Surgical teams require retractors that minimize tissue trauma (atraumatic tissue contact), offer effortless self-retaining locking mechanisms (such as Balfour, Bookwalter, and Deaver configurations), and withstand rigorous reprocessing schedules in hospital Sterile Processing Departments (SPD). Choosing the correct stainless steel alloy and passivation treatment ensures instrument durability, corrosion resistance, and longevity in LA hospital SPD facilities.
| Steel / Material Grade | Hardness (HRC) | Corrosion Resistance | Primary Surgical Application | Autoclave Tolerance (134°C) |
|---|---|---|---|---|
| AISI 420 (Martensitic) | 50 – 54 HRC | High (Passivated) | Manual Retractor Blades, Scissors, Forceps | > 1,500 Cycles |
| AISI 304 / 316L (Austenitic) | 25 – 30 HRC | Superior (Non-Magnetic) | Self-Retaining Frames, Trays, Baskets | > 3,000 Cycles |
| Titanium Grade 5 (Ti-6Al-4V) | 36 – 40 HRC | Ultra-High (Immune to Saline) | Non-Stick Bipolar Forceps, Micro-Retractors | > 5,000 Cycles |
| German Martensitic 1.4021 | 48 – 52 HRC | High (Nitric Passivated) | Balfour & Deaver Retractor Assemblies | > 2,000 Cycles |

In fast-paced emergency surgical suites at LAC+USC Medical Center and Harbor-UCLA, trauma surgeons require rapid-frame abdominal retractors (such as self-retaining Balfour or Gosset systems). These systems provide instant, stable 3-way retraction of the abdominal wall during exploratory laparotomies for blunt abdominal trauma, hemorrhage control, and organ stabilization.
Ambulatory Surgery Centers (ASCs) focusing on minimally invasive gynecology, bariatric, and plastic surgery require lightweight, ergonomic hand-held retractors (such as Richardson, Kelly, and Deaver patterns) alongside fine bayonet bipolar forceps. Premium non-stick coatings ensure tissue non-adhesion during rapid outpatient procedures.
Multi-organ transplantation and oncology suites at Cedars-Sinai and Keck Medicine utilize modular table-mounted retractor ring systems (such as Bookwalter-style assemblies). These allow multi-angle, precise tissue retraction over 6–10 hour surgical operations without inducing muscle fatigue for the surgical team.

With the full enforcement of US FDA Unique Device Identification (UDI) regulations, healthcare facilities across California require clear, permanent, autoclave-resistant fiber laser markings on all reusable surgical hand tools. Modern OEM exporters now provide integrated laser marking of custom hospital logos, catalog references (REF), lot numbers (LOT), and 2D DataMatrix barcodes directly at the factory level.
